Plain Cupcake Recipe

( add your special little extras to make them uniquely yours!)

125g butter

1 tsp vanilla essence

3/4 cup caster sugar

2 eggs

1&1/2 cups SR flour

1/2 cup milk


Cream butter, essence and sugar in small bowl

with electric mixer until light and fluffy.

Beat in eggs one at a time, beat until combined.

Stir in half the sifted flour and half the milk,

then stir in remaining flour and milk.

Pour mixture into 12 patty pans (in a 12-hole muffin tray.)

Bake for 15 minutes in a moderate oven 190-200,

or if you want them 'peaked' slightly,

increase to moderately hot (210-220)
